    I think this helps explain how to fix this HDMI Audio issue running Windows via Bootcamp. (I'm running Win 8)
    1. Go to Programs on the Control Panel
    2. Uninstall Intel HD Graphics Driver
    3. Restart computer
    4. Go to Intel's Driver Support website and download the driver.http://downloadcenter.intel.com/
    (I'd reccomend just selecting the auto scan and it will show you what drivers you can install)
    5. Install the Intel HD Graphics Driver
    6. Restart computer
    7. Go to Hardware and Sound on the Control Panel
    8. Click on Sound and the Intel Display Audio should display now and set it as default
    Hope this helps with anyone experiencing this same issue.

    Mac Mini Intel Core Duo's did not ship until 2006 which seems plenty of time for Apple to announce 'we have a problem' and what their recommended solution.
    Why would they do that ? I mean, they don't have a problem. The inventors of DualDisc made a type of disc that won't play in all players, and Apple can't really do anything about it. Superdrives are not made by Apple, it's just Apple's name for a DVD burner; the Superdrives that are found in various Macs come from several different manufacturers, and although Apple probably ensures that the Superdrive and the Mac work well together, they won't test whether it works with each type of disc (usually, the manufacturer will).
    However, that is probably limited to redbook/standards-compliant discs; since a DualDisc's CD side doesn't comply with any standard other than "DualDisc", and because it is not considered important enough to be officially supported by most (if not all) manufacturers, they probably won't test them since they're bound to get mixed results anyway.
    Similarly I don't remember seeing a "strictly redbook only" disclaimer on any of the media available from Apple describing the capabilities of its Superdrive when I was making my mac mini buying decision.
    You didn't see one because it is not required. Asking that Apple (or any other company) warns you that their players won't play non-redbook CDs is a bit like asking that they tell you everything your optical drive won't play. Apple claims that their Superdrives will read CD-R/RW, DVD-R/RW, DVD+R/RW, DVD-R DL, which aren't only a bunch of weird-looking letters, but also correspond to a standard. When you see a CD logo on a drive, it means that it will play redbook-compliant CDs. Your Dell player simply does more that what it is supposedly capable of, but because one (or many) optical drives will play DualDisc doesn't mean that they all have to.

  • Lion won't install on my Mac mini. Why?

    I have a 2 yr old Mac mini with 2.53 GHz Core Duo CPU, 4 GB of RAM and it's running 10.6.8. I just downloaded Lion but the installer says it can't install on my HD. Why not? I cannot find any info about what to do.
    Is there some software on my computer that the installer does not like?
    Does Lion need a completely new partition to install on?
    If so, why is this not mentioned anywhere ?
    Thankyou for your help.

    Lion creates a recovery area with a minimal version of OS X and it may be unable to do so due to use over the years, and possibly other resizing operations (Boot Camp).  It could just need more space, if you only have less than 8gb free.  Lion shuffles and merges the two systems when it upgrades.  You can burn the image downloaded from App Store by finding the dmg file inside the "Install Mac OS X Lion.app" bundle, dragging it into disk utility, then burning from there.
    Otherwise, you can appropriate a MBR/BIOS formatted 4GB thumbdrive, 8GB of either EFI or MBR/BIOS thumbdrive, flash storage device, or external hard drive, and format it, using the restore operation through disk utility to copy the contents of the installer disk to the media.  Exposed via the alt key before the Apple logo, should show the bootable media, where you can format over the former installation.
    As always, backup your files when upgrading.  I recommend if your installion is over a year old to wipe and upgrade if you can't make otherwise the media bootable, using your 10.6 recovery dvd.
    If you cannot find an external medium to backup your files before the upgrade, if you need to format via disk utility (Through 10.6 media), you can consider Dropbox as an option (2GB free account).
    It's not uncommon for the partition to simply refuse operations, including upgrades and resizing.
